heir apparent
English Thesaurus
1. an heir whose right to an inheritance cannot be defeated if that person outlives the ancestor (noun.person)
| antonym | : | heir presumptive, |
| definition | : | a person who expects to inherit but whose right can be defeated by the birth of a nearer relative (noun.person) |
